对象存储的哪种特性限制了数据,对象存储的冗余特性如何限制数据扩展与优化
- 综合资讯
- 2024-12-02 03:40:03
- 2

对象存储的冗余特性限制了数据扩展与优化。冗余特性通过复制数据以保障数据安全性,但这同时也增加了存储空间需求,限制了数据量的扩展。冗余管理增加了系统复杂度,降低了优化效率...
对象存储的冗余特性限制了数据扩展与优化。冗余特性通过复制数据以保障数据安全性,但这同时也增加了存储空间需求,限制了数据量的扩展。冗余管理增加了系统复杂度,降低了优化效率,影响整体性能。
在云计算领域,对象存储作为一种重要的数据存储技术,凭借其高可靠性、可扩展性和易用性等特点,受到了广泛的关注和应用,在享受对象存储带来的便利的同时,我们也需要认识到,对象存储的某些特性可能会对数据扩展和优化产生限制,本文将重点探讨对象存储的冗余特性如何限制数据并分析其影响。
对象存储的冗余特性
1、数据冗余
对象存储采用数据冗余技术,将数据复制存储在多个节点上,以确保数据的可靠性和安全性,当其中一个节点发生故障时,其他节点可以继续提供服务,从而保证数据的完整性,这种冗余特性使得对象存储具有较高的可靠性,但同时也带来了数据冗余。
2、节点冗余
对象存储系统通常采用分布式架构,将数据分散存储在多个节点上,这种节点冗余可以提高系统的可扩展性和性能,但同时也增加了数据管理的复杂性。
冗余特性对数据扩展的限制
1、数据量增加带来的存储空间浪费
由于数据冗余,对象存储系统中每个数据块都需要在多个节点上存储,导致存储空间浪费,当数据量增加时,这种浪费现象会更加严重,从而限制了数据扩展。
2、存储成本上升
数据冗余导致存储空间浪费,使得存储成本上升,在数据量较大的场景下,存储成本的增加会对企业造成较大的经济负担。
3、数据管理复杂度提高
数据冗余使得数据管理变得更加复杂,在数据量较大、节点较多的场景下,数据迁移、备份、恢复等操作需要消耗更多的时间和资源。
冗余特性对数据优化的限制
1、数据检索效率降低
由于数据冗余,数据分布在多个节点上,导致数据检索效率降低,在检索大量数据时,需要遍历多个节点,增加了检索时间。
2、数据同步开销增加
数据冗余导致数据需要在多个节点之间同步,增加了数据同步开销,在数据量较大的场景下,这种开销会更加明显。
3、系统性能受限
数据冗余和节点冗余导致系统性能受限,在处理大量并发请求时,系统需要处理更多的数据同步和存储操作,从而影响了系统性能。
解决方案
1、优化数据冗余策略
针对数据冗余问题,可以采用以下策略:
(1)根据数据访问频率调整冗余级别,对访问频率较高的数据采用较高冗余级别,对访问频率较低的数据采用较低冗余级别。
(2)采用数据压缩技术,降低数据冗余。
2、优化节点冗余策略
针对节点冗余问题,可以采用以下策略:
(1)采用负载均衡技术,合理分配请求到各个节点。
(2)根据业务需求调整节点数量,避免过度冗余。
3、引入分布式缓存技术
通过引入分布式缓存技术,可以降低数据检索开销,提高数据检索效率。
4、采用智能存储技术
智能存储技术可以根据数据访问模式自动调整存储策略,降低数据冗余,提高存储空间利用率。
对象存储的冗余特性在保证数据可靠性和安全性的同时,也对数据扩展和优化产生了一定的限制,为了克服这些限制,我们需要从数据冗余、节点冗余、数据检索和系统性能等方面入手,采取相应的优化策略,通过不断优化,使对象存储更好地服务于云计算环境下的数据存储需求。
本文链接:https://www.zhitaoyun.cn/1253339.html
发表评论